Transaction 22ea58751b0654147a76b792b1cac329532ca2e258c3124a3bc79421e4d14571
1 Input
2 Outputs
- 22ea58751b0654147a76b792b1cac329532ca2e258c3124a3bc79421e4d14571:0
- 22ea58751b0654147a76b792b1cac329532ca2e258c3124a3bc79421e4d14571:1
value 14851779
address 3GGhdSY96szDKGkfkQ1Dr2FiYJ1g6AjnAr
value 53581638
address 1PrHzKSGcG9ANfiDMRvSR1LPzGVrbPACn3